MZWAA SHARES NEW MUSIC

Local musician Mzwaa has released a new single titled ‘Khumbule’. The new single was revealed by the musician on his Instagram account. The news were also trending on Antidote Music Instagram account, where a cover of the single was also used in announcing the news. Mzwaa’s Instagram post was complement­ed by a wordy caption, which read; “It’s been a while since I dropped some music but thank you for being patient. This Friday (meaning yesterday) I drop my first single for the year,”. The track was produced by Truhitz and Thisiscoka­yn. OSCAR MBO FOR HOUSE MUSIC FEST

Guys have you heard? Oscar Mbo has been added to this year’s House Music Fest. This was announced by SwaziBoy Entertainm­ent on Wednesday evening. Comments started flooding in the local entertainm­ent stable Instagram page as soon as Oscar’s post was uploaded on their page. In case you are lost, Oscar Mbongeni Ndlovu, is a South African record producer, podcaster and DJ. He creates house music containing elements of deep House, Deep Tech, Nu Jazz, broken beat and Lounge music. He is best known for his founding and starring roles in the entertainm­ent podcast, The Ashmed Hour show. This talented soul will be playing live at Manzini Club on March 25, alongside DJ Zinhle and Oskido.

TOM TIGER TICKESTS 70% SOLD OUT

Local fans are really enjoying themselves in the local entertainm­ent industry. I mean, just think of it, the Mega Lounge show dubbed ‘Tom tiger invades Eswatini’ which is slated to take place on March 25 has its tickets marked as 70 per cent sold out as from Wednesday. That is really good news. This show will feature South African musician Vetkuk and Mahoota, Lesego M, Big Nuz, Leehleza as well as Ezra to name a few.
